ProKeys Sono can function as the centerpiece of a simple live performance setup.
Connect a Microphone and an Instrument (such as an electric guitar or bass) to
ProKeys Sono and use the Microphone and Instrument gain knobs to set the input
levels. Next, use the Direct Monitor knob to set the overall level of the microphone
and instrument inputs in the mix. Finally, adjust the level of the keyboard’s built-in
sounds by using the Voice Volume knob.
If you connected the line outputs of an external device to the aux inputs of ProKeys
Sono, the volume level of that device may need to be adjusted at the external device
itself.
The mixed signal of Microphone, Instrument, Aux input and built-in sounds will be
available on both headphone outputs and the rear-panel 1/4” outputs.
Use the Master Volume slider to adjust the overall output level.
NOTE: ProKeys Sono is capable of many advanced features which can be accessed via the
ProKeys Sono Edit mode. Many of these features can be useful when ProKeys Sono is operating in
Standalone mode. Additional information concerning these features can be found in the “Advanced
ProKeys Sono Functions in Edit Mode” chapter of this User Guide.
ProKeys Sono Demos
ProKeys Sono has a built-in demo song for each instrument sound. To hear these demos:
1. Press the Edit Mode button.
2. Press one of the Voice Select buttons.
Demo playback can be stopped by pressing the Edit Mode button. While the demo is playing, the LED of the selected voice
will flash. At the completion of the demo, the demo song will repeat.
Tip: Connect the MIDI Out jack
of ProKeys Sono to an external
MIDI synthesizer or sound module.
Connect the Line outputs of the
external device to the Aux inputs
on ProKeys Sono. If you play the
ProKeys Sono keyboard, you will
trigger MIDI sounds on the external
MIDI synthesizer, and can hear them
back through the ProKeys Sono main
outputs.
